SPECIFICATIONS:

Part Number: 5463-388
Manufacturer: Woodward
Series: NetCon 5000 / MicroNet
Product Type: SIO (Serial I/O) CPU Controller Module
Processor Architecture: High-speed RISC-based processing
Data Bus Width: 32-bit internal architecture
Dimensions: 16cm x 16cm x 12cm
Weight: 0.95 kg

FUNCTIONAL DESCRIPTION:

The 5463-388 is a high-performance SIO CPU Controller Module engineered by Woodward to serve as the computational backbone within the NetCon 5000 and MicroNet control architectures. It manages the deterministic execution of complex gas turbine control logic by performing high-speed instruction fetching, decoding, and execution cycles. This module acts as the primary intelligence hub, bridging the primary processing core with distributed I/O subsystems. By coordinating real-time data arbitration across the system bus, the CPU Controller Module ensures that critical turbine parameters are governed with the sub-millisecond precision required for modern, high-efficiency power generation.
